There comes a point in every person’s life when they recognize their calling. And, it is pretty clear that two of our writers, Justin Bell and Andrew Lynch, love spending time in Essen, Germany for the SPIEL Essen tabletop convention each fall.
For the first time since COVID, the show (which we will refer to as “SPIEL” for the rest of this article) reverted back to its pre-COVID date routine of a late October start, with this year’s show taking place October 23-26 at the Messe Essen exhibit halls south of the Essen city center.
Here’s how big the show is now: this year, Hall 7 was included in the show’s layout, expanding beyond the first six halls to become a signature area for some of the world’s biggest publishers, including Asmodee and Ravensburger. SPIEL has gotten so big that there are roughly two halls dedicated only to RPGs, CCG/TCGs, artists avenues, and clothing shops. This place is massive, people!
That was great news for our team, in part because that allowed us to narrow our focus to just Halls 2-6. With dozens of meetings to hit and thousands—hundreds of thousands—of fans in the building, that made it a little bit easier to focus.
